Rallies for Navalny on the day of Putin's message: peacefully in Moscow, viciously in St. Petersburg

On April 21, rallies were held in Russia in support of opposition politician Alexey Navalny, who was imprisoned for 3.5 years. According to the estimates of the Ministry of Internal Affairs of Russia and independent observers, from 10,000 to 30,000 Russians attended the rally in Moscow, and only a few thousand in St. Petersburg. In addition, on the same day, Russian President Vladimir Putin delivered a message to the Federal assembly.

Mobilization in Ukraine: who will the law on reservists be applied to

President Volodymyr Zelenskyy signed a law allowing to call up reservists for military service without announcing mobilization during a special period. Such a decision will make it possible to fill the ranks of the military units and increase the state's combat capability in the event of the military aggression escalation in Donbas.

Zelenskyy's address, photos of Russian troops and US support: what is happening in Donbas and Crimea

In Crimea, the number of Russian troops on the border with Ukraine turned out to be more than military experts expected. In particular, satellites recorded several Su-30 fighters at an airbase on the territory of the occupied peninsula that were not there in March.

Russia has restricted flights over Crimea and the Black Sea

Russia temporarily from 20 to 24 April has restricted flights over part of Crimea and the Black Sea. In particular, this area has been declared temporarily dangerous for flights.

Paid coronavirus vaccine: the Ministry of Health has proposed to postpone it until 2022

In 2021, there will be no paid coronavirus vaccine in Ukraine. The reason is the shortage of vaccines, since they are produced in small batches.
